Patent number: 11739844Abstract: Two conflicting functions of sealing and lubrication of sliding faces are achieved for a long time. The sliding face of a rotating-side seal ring 3 is provided with dynamic pressure generation grooves 11 configured to communicate with the circumferential edge on the inner peripheral side of the sliding face and not to communicate with the circumferential edge on the outer peripheral side. A spring 7 is provided on the back side of a stationary-side seal ring 6 for pressing the stationary-side seal ring 6 against the sliding face of the rotating-side seal ring 3. A spring holder 8 is provided between the back side of the stationary-side seal ring 6 and the spring 7.Type: GrantFiled: September 7, 2017Date of Patent: August 29, 2023Inventors: Hikaru Katori, Keiichi Chiba, Masatoshi Itadani, Tadahiro Kimura, Akira Yoshino

Publication number: 20230235780Abstract: An annular sliding component includes a sliding surface provided with a plurality of fluid introduction grooves communicating with a space on the side of a sealing target fluid and introducing the sealing target fluid thereinto and a plurality of inclined grooves extending from a leakage side toward the sealing target fluid and generating a dynamic pressure and the sliding surface of the sliding component is provided with a reverse inclined groove which is provided on the side of the sealing target fluid of the inclined groove, extends in a reverse direction with respect to the inclined groove, and generates a dynamic pressure.Type: ApplicationFiled: May 31, 2021Publication date: July 27, 2023Inventors: Yuta NEGISHI, Ryosuke UCHIYAMA, Hiroki INOUE, Minori ONUMA, Yoshiaki TAKIGAHIRA, Hikaru KATORI, Nobuo NAKAHARA, Takeshi HOSOE

Patent number: 11221074Abstract: The purpose of the present invention is to provide a mechanical seal in which a stationary-side sealing ring can follow the movement of a rotating-side sealing ring to provide reliable sealing properties and by which the entire device can be made compact. A mechanical seal in which a rotating-side sealing ring 13 attached to a shaft 2 and a stationary-side sealing ring 21 attached to a housing 3 slide relative to each other and seal between the housing 3 and the shaft 2 includes a case 22 which is attached to the housing 3 and which contains the stationary-side sealing ring 21, and a seal member 23 which is disposed between the case 22 and the stationary-side sealing ring 21, and the case 22 includes a holding part 22d which regulates the seal member 23 from moving to both sides in the axial direction thereof.Type: GrantFiled: September 19, 2018Date of Patent: January 11, 2022Assignee: EAGLE INDUSTRY CO., LTD.Inventors: Tadahiro Kimura, Hikaru Katori, Masatoshi Itadani, Takeshi Hosoe, Yasuhiro Ikeda, Tomoko Yamaki

Patent number: 10704417Abstract: Both conflicting functions of sealing and lubrication of sliding faces are made compatible over an entire period from the time of startup through the time of steady operation. A pair of sliding parts that relatively slide on each other is provided, one of the sliding parts being a stationary-side seal ring, the other of the sliding parts being a rotating-side seal ring, the seal rings each having a sliding face S formed radially for sealing sealed fluid from leaking, at least one of the sliding faces S being provided with fluid introduction grooves 10 configured to communicate with a first peripheral edge of the sliding face S and not to communicate with a second peripheral edge, and being provided with dynamic pressure generation grooves configured to communicate with the second peripheral edge of the sliding face S and not to communicate with the first peripheral edge.Type: GrantFiled: April 13, 2016Date of Patent: July 7, 2020Assignee: EAGLE INDUSTRY CO., LTD.Inventors: Yuichiro Tokunaga, Keiichi Chiba, Masatoshi Itadani, Hikaru Katori, Wataru Kimura

Patent number: 10598286Abstract: In an embodiments, in a sealing face of at least one slide part of a pair of slide parts, a dynamic pressure generation groove 10 is provided so as to be separated not to communicate with a sealed fluid side and a leakage side by land portions on both sealing faces, between an end 10a on the leakage side of the dynamic pressure generation groove 10 and the leakage side, a fluid introduction groove 11 which communicates the dynamic pressure generation groove 10 and the leakage side is provided, and the cross-sectional area of the fluid introduction groove 11 is set smaller than the cross-sectional area of the dynamic pressure generation groove 10. The sealing faces are subjected to fluid lubrication and low friction in a steady operation, and leakage of the sealed fluid and entrance of dust into the sealing faces are suppressed.Type: GrantFiled: May 13, 2016Date of Patent: March 24, 2020Assignee: EAGLE INDUSTRY CO., LTD.Inventors: Yuichiro Tokunaga, Hideyuki Inoue, Wataru Kimura, Tetsuya Iguchi, Takeshi Hosoe, Hidetoshi Kasahara, Takafumi Ota, Keiichi Chiba, Masatoshi Itadani, Hikaru Katori

Patent number: 10473220Abstract: In an embodiment, in a slide component, dynamic pressure generation grooves 10 are provided on a sealing face of at least one of a pair of slide parts 4, 7 so as to be isolated with no communication from the sealed fluid side and the leakage side by land portions R of both the sealing faces, and a plurality of independently-formed minute recessed sections 11 is provided at positions on the sealing face IS between the dynamic pressure generation grooves 10 and the leakage side, the positions being separated in the radial direction from the dynamic pressure generation grooves. The slide component can make the sealing faces fluid-lubricant and low frictional and prevent leakage of a sealed fluid and incoming of dust to the sealing faces at the time of normal operation.Type: GrantFiled: May 13, 2016Date of Patent: November 12, 2019Assignee: EAGLE INDUSTRY CO., LTD.Inventors: Yuichiro Tokunaga, Hideyuki Inoue, Wataru Kimura, Tetsuya Iguchi, Takeshi Hosoe, Hidetoshi Kasahara, Takafumi Ota, Keiichi Chiba, Masatoshi Itadani, Hikaru Katori

Patent number: 10337620Abstract: In an embodiment, a sliding component includes a pair of sliding parts (a stationary-side seal ring 7 and a rotating-side seal ring 4) that relatively slide on each other and each have a sliding face S formed radially for sealing sealed fluid from leaking. The sliding face S of at least one sliding part is provided with dynamic pressure generation grooves 10 spaced in a non-communicating manner from the sealed-fluid side and the leakage side by lands R of both sliding faces, and is provided with fluid introduction holes 11 between leakage-side ends 10a of the grooves 10 and the leakage side, for communicating the grooves 10 and the leakage side. Each fluid introduction holes 11 is configured such that a dynamic-pressure-generation-groove-side opening 11a open to a corresponding one of the grooves 10 is axially displaced from a leakage-side opening 11b open to the leakage side.Type: GrantFiled: May 13, 2016Date of Patent: July 2, 2019Assignee: EAGLE INDUSTRY CO., LTD.Inventors: Yuichiro Tokunaga, Hideyuki Inoue, Wataru Kimura, Tetsuya Iguchi, Keiichi Chiba, Masatoshi Itadani, Hikaru Katori

Patent number: 10337560Abstract: In an embodiment, a sliding face of at least one sliding part of the pair of sliding parts is provided, along its entire circumference, with a trap groove 10 for trapping leakage fluid, located on a leakage side and spaced from the leakage side by a land. A dust entry reduction means 12 for reducing entry of dust from the leakage side while allowing passage of fluid is formed between lands of the pair of sliding parts on the leakage side of the trap groove 10. At the sliding faces of the pair of sliding parts sliding relatively, entry of dust from the leakage side as well as liquid leakage to the leakage side are suppressed.Type: GrantFiled: May 13, 2016Date of Patent: July 2, 2019Assignee: EAGLE INDUSTRY CO., LTD.Inventors: Yuichiro Tokunaga, Hideyuki Inoue, Wataru Kimura, Tetsuya Iguchi, Keiichi Chiba, Masatoshi Itadani, Hikaru Katori

Patent number: 10054230Abstract: Provided is a mechanical seal includes a fluid introduction groove provided in a sealing face of a stationary sealing ring and having an opening portion which is opened to the sealed fluid and an end portion which is provided opposite to the opening portion. The end portion being located between respective sealing faces S, the fluid introduction groove introducing the sealed fluid from the opening portion to a clearance between the respective sealing faces S. The fluid introduction groove is provided to be inclined at an acute angle to the sealing face S of the stationary sealing ring in a direction from the end portion to the opening portion.Type: GrantFiled: September 3, 2015Date of Patent: August 21, 2018Assignee: EAGLES INDUSTRY CO., LTD.Inventors: Hikaru Katori, Keiichi Chiba, Masatoshi Itadani

Publication number: 20180187785Abstract: In an embodiment, in a sliding component, a sliding face S at least one sliding part of a pair of sliding parts is provided with positive pressure generation mechanisms 10 which generate dynamic pressure, an annular pressure release groove 11, and radial grooves 12 which intersect the pressure release groove 11, in which corners 13a and 13b at an intersecting portion of the pressure release groove 11 and the radial grooves 12 are each formed in a curved surface shape such that the pressure release groove 11 and the radial groove 12 are joined by a smooth curved surface. The sliding component can prevent generation of cavitation in a pressure release groove and a radial groove without setting depths of the grooves to be deeper than necessary.Type: ApplicationFiled: June 20, 2016Publication date: July 5, 2018Inventors: Hikaru KATORI, Masatoshi ITADANI, Yuichiro TOKUNAGA, Keiichi CHIBA
